Chemours, DuPont Lose, for Now, Bid to Exit PFAS Damage Case

Sept. 30, 2025, 10:16 PM UTC

A federal district court says Chemours and DuPont must continue to defend themselves against claims that their PFAS releases in North Carolina damaged residents’ properties.

The US District Court for the Eastern District of North Carolina denied motions from the Chemours Co. FC LLC and E.I. du Pont de Nemours & Co. to decertify a court-approved class of residents and to dismiss their property damage claims.

But, the companies may be able to bring those motions again after the court has heard additional expert testimony, said Judge James C. Dever III’s order.
